Wood balcony rep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the structural integrity and appearance of outdoor wooden balconies. These services typically involve inspecting the existing wood for signs of damage, such as rot, splintering, or warping, and then performing necessary repairs or replacements. The work may include reinforcing support beams, replacing damaged decking boards, and applying protective finishes to prevent future deterioration. Skilled service providers ensure that the balcony remains safe to use and visually appealing, helping homeowners extend the lifespan of their outdoor living spaces.
Many common problems can be addressed through professional balcony repair. Over time, exposure to moisture, temperature fluctuations, and general wear can cause wood to weaken, crack, or decay. This can lead to safety hazards like loose or unstable decking and support structures. Additionally, untreated or poorly maintained wood may develop mold, mildew, or insect damage. Repair services help resolve these issues by replacing compromised wood, reinforcing structural elements, and applying weather-resistant treatments to prevent further damage, ensuring the balcony remains secure and functional.

The overview below groups typical Wood Balcony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in West Bloomfield,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Most minor wood balcony repairs in West Bloomfield typically range from $250 to $600. These projects often involve replacing damaged boards or fixing minor rot and usually fall within the middle of the cost spectrum. Fewer jobs require extensive work that exceeds this range.
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, such as replacing larger sections of wood or addressing structural issues,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. Many local contractors handle these projects regularly, which tend to stay within this middle-to-upper range.
Major Renovations - Complete balcony refurbishments or significant repairs can range from $1,500 to $3,500, depending on the scope and materials used. Larger or more complex projects may push beyond this, but most stay within this bracket.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ire wood balcony often costs $3,500 to $8,000 or more, especially for larger, multi-level structures or those requiring custom work. While fewer projects reach this high, local service providers can handle these comprehensive replacements when need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ood balcony damage can local contractors repair? Local contractors can handle a variety of issues including rotting wood, cracked or splintered boards, loose railings, and structural concerns caused by moisture or age-related wear.
How do professionals typically assess wood balcony repair needs? Contractors usually perform a visual inspection to identify damaged areas, check for stability, and evaluate the extent of rot or deterioration to determine necessary repairs.
What common repair methods are used for wood balcony restoration? Repair methods may include replacing damaged boards, reinforcing or tightening railings, applying protective coatings, and sealing wood to prevent future damage.
Are there specific materials that local service providers prefer for balcony repairs? Many contractors use pressure-treated wood, composite materials, or weather-resistant finishes to ensure durability and longevity of balcony structures.
